Soir de Lune by Sisley was launched in 2006 and is composed by Dominique Ropion, widely regarded as an 'underrated masterpiece' among perfume enthusiasts. This Chypre Floral fragrance opens with the freshness of citrus and spicy notes like coriander and pepper oil, which give way to a heart of floral accords such as rose, mimosa, iris, jasmine, and lily-of-the-valley. The base notes of oakmoss, patchouli, musk, and sandalwood create an earthy and mossy warmth that anchors the composition. Despite Sisley's low profile in fragrance circles, Soir de Lune is often compared to the serious chypre constructions found in collections like Frédéric Malle or Chanel Les Exclusifs.

Application Tips
Apply Soir de Lune lightly — its base notes take time to develop and can be overwhelming in excess. Two sprays are usually enough for the warm, mossy base to unfold gradually throughout the evening.
Dominique Ropion
Founding perfumer · 344 fragrances · French

Dominique Ropion is a daring perfectionist, a true inventor. The risks he takes are invariably accompanied by a relentless pursuit of exact olfactory balance and flawless composition. His perfumes are like great architectural feats: in the same way that a bridge, whose seemingly miraculous suspension of weight is in fact a harnessing of counteracting forces, Dominique often balances excessive doses of powerful ingredients with meticulously-measured, subtler accords, until the composition holds up on its own. A good perfume, he likes to say, must always appear obvious.
